Lead Software Engineer
Appinventiv Noida
Job Description
Hiring Tech Lead/Asso. Tech Lead - DevOps.
Job Overview- Knowledge of cloud environments (AWS, GCP, Azure)
- Strong knowledge of cloudformation or terraform.
- Strong background in Linux Administration
- Experience in Continuous Integration and Build tools such as codepipeline, Jenkins, Ansible & azure devops tool etc.
- Experience in GIT workflows for multiple properties and APIs
- Experience in Linux/Perl/Python/Unix Shell/Ansible Scripts - to handle complex automation/administration tasks
- Excellent analytical, problem-solving skills and attention to detail; mission-critical production support experience.
- Strong written and verbal communication skills and experience in working effectively in cross-functional team
- Experience in Microservice application fabric, knowledge of single-page applications
- Redis, relational & non relational database management.
- Experienced in Agile methodology
- B.E/B.Tech/MCA with 5 to 8 years of experience in Java, Spring tech stack ecosystem.
- Experience in end-to-end application development.
- Experience of development & delivery using Agile methodologies like Scrum or Scaled Agile frameworks.
- Should be able to define technical architecture, hands-on coder, maintaining standards, and other team policies
- Experience in leading a team of at least 3 people
- Experience in frameworks like Spring, SpringBoot, Hibernate etc
- Experience in development of microservices based applications & REST APIs.
- Experience in Continuous Integration and build tools (Maven, Jenkins, Gradle)
- Experience in writing UTCs and conducting code reviews.
- Good knowledge of Design Patterns
- Understanding of latest technologies and tools in the Java/JEE space and using them
- Good experience with databases like MySQL or Oracle or any NoSQL like MongoDB
- Know how around integration patterns for queuing, caching, etc.
- Experience in cloud computing or Linux would be a plus
- Problem solving & logical thinking.
- Good verbal & written communication skills.
- Self driven & mentor for the team.
- Comfortable to contribute both as a team lead as well as an individual
Global PaymentsNoida
in-depth expertise and advice to software engineers.
What Are We Looking For in This Role
Minimum Qualifications
• BS in Computer Science, Information Technology, Business / Management Information Systems or related field
• Typically minimum of 6 years...
Noida
Job Description
Works in the area of Software Engineering, which encompasses the development, maintenance and optimization of software solutions/applications.
1. Applies scientific methods to analyse and solve software engineering problems.
2. He...
Siemens TechnologyNoida
/ ECE/Computer Science (CS) from top reputed Engineering colleges with 4-8 years of significant experience in software development. Experience in EDA will be a plus!
• Proficiency in C/C++ languages, design patterns along with data structure...